What is the sum of the interior angles of an octagon? a. 720° b. 900° c. 1080° d. 1260°

look how many separate triangles you can make in an octagon
you can make 6 so 6*180 = angles in the octagon
you can always make 2 triangles less than the number of total points for example 3 points 1 triangle 4 points - square has 2 triangles = 360 degrees 5 points - pentagon has 3 triangles = 3*180=540 degrees 6 points-hexdagon has 4 triangles = 4*180 = 720 and so on
8 points, octagon - 6 triangles = 6*180 = 600 + 80 * 6 = 600+480 = 1080

Method 1 sum of interior angles of a polygon = (n – 2) × 180 in octagon number of sides n = 8 sum of interior angles = (8 – 2) × 180 = 1080 Method 2 sum of exterior angles of polygon is always 360° and each exterior angle = 360/n = 360/8 = 45° so so each interior angle = 180 – 45 = 135° so sum of 8 interior angles = 8 × 135 = 1080°
